Venerable mother of liberation), is an important female buddha in buddhism, especially revered in vajrayana buddhism and mahayana buddhism. Of all the buddhas, green tara is the most accessible. In buddhism, tara is a savior deity (savioress) who liberates souls from suffering
She is recognized as a bodhisattva (essence of enlightenment) in mahayana buddhism and as a buddha and the mother of buddhas in esoteric buddhism, particularly vajrayana buddhism (also known as tibetan buddhism).
Tara, wisdom mother of the buddhas, compassionate activity of all the buddhas, tara the rescuer and her many aspects Tibetans usually think of tara as having 21 manifestations, as she does in the common tibetan buddhist prayer — in praise of the 21 taras In each form she takes a different color — like blue tara and black tara — and offers a different energy or virtue to help us on our spiritual paths. Originally a hindu goddess, tārā was absorbed into the buddhist pantheon during the sixth century c.e
And is represented in different forms in buddhist iconography Known as a bodhisattva of compassion, as well as a tantric deity and mother goddess, it is said that tārā guards and protects her devotees their whole lives.
